Identifying Common Door Issues
Before diving into the repair procedure, it's necessary to identify the particular concerns your door is dealing with. Here are some common issues and their signs:
Sticking or Binding Doors
Symptoms: The composite pivot door repair is tough to open or close, or it doesn't latch effectively.Causes: Warping, misalignment, or inflamed wood.
Gaps Around the Door
Signs: Drafts, cold air, or light coming through the spaces.Causes: Loose or damaged weatherstripping, gaps in the frame.
Loose or Damaged Hinges
Signs: The composite door restoration sags, or the hinges are noisy.Causes: Loose screws, worn-out hinges, or damaged hinge plates.
Broken Locks or Latches
Signs: The door will not lock, or the lock is stuck.Causes: Worn-out mechanisms, damaged elements, or incorrect installation.
Cracked or Damaged Panels

The expense of door repairs can differ commonly depending on the level of the damage and the products required. Here's a breakdown of common costs for different repairs:
Sticking or Binding Doors
Products Needed: Wood filler, sandpaper, lube.Expense: ₤ 5 - ₤ 20.Labor: DIY (totally free) or professional (₤ 50 - ₤ 100).
Gaps Around the Door
Materials Needed: Weatherstripping, caulk.Cost: ₤ 10 - ₤ 50.Labor: DIY (free) or professional (₤ 50 - ₤ 100).
Loose or Damaged Hinges
Materials Needed: New screws, lube, replacement hinges.Cost: ₤ 10 - ₤ 30.Labor: DIY (free) or professional (₤ 50 - ₤ 100).
Broken Locks or Latches
Materials Needed: New lock or latch system.Cost: ₤ 20 - ₤ 100.Labor: DIY (complimentary) or professional (₤ 100 - ₤ 200).

Sticking or Binding Doors
Action 1: Identify the cause. Inspect for warping, misalignment, or swollen wood.Action 2: Apply wood filler to any spaces or fractures.Action 3: Sand the door surface area to make sure a smooth finish.Step 4: Apply a lube to the hinges and lock mechanism.
Gaps Around the Door
Step 1: Remove old weatherstripping or caulk.Action 2: Measure the gaps and cut the new weatherstripping to size.Step 3: Install the weatherstripping along the spaces.Step 4: Apply caulk to any remaining gaps for a seal.
Loose or Damaged Hinges
Action 1: Remove the old screws and tidy the hinge holes.Step 2: Use longer screws to secure the hinges more strongly.Action 3: Apply a lubricant to the hinges to decrease sound.Step 4: If essential, change the hinges with new ones.
Broken Locks or Latches
Action 1: Remove the old lock or lock system.Action 2: Measure the measurements of the brand-new system.Action 3: Install the brand-new lock or latch, guaranteeing it is lined up properly.Step 4: Test the lock to ensure it works properly.

Q: Can I repair a door myself, or should I employ a professional composite door repair?
A: Many door repairs can be managed DIY, particularly for small issues like sticking doors or spaces. However, for more complex problems like broken locks or comprehensive damage, employing a professional may be more cost-effective and make sure an appropriate repair.
Q: How frequently should I check my doors for maintenance?
A: It's a good idea to check your doors at least once a year for indications of wear and tear. Regular maintenance can assist prevent small issues from becoming significant problems.
Q: What are some preventive steps to avoid door repairs?
A: Keep your doors properly maintained by frequently lubing hinges, checking weatherstripping, and dealing with any small problems quickly. Additionally, ensure appropriate ventilation to avoid warping and swelling.
Q: Can I utilize any kind of wood filler for door repairs?
A: It's best to utilize a wood filler that is specifically created for the type of wood your door is made from. This will make sure a much better match and a more resilient repair.
Q: How can I tell if my door is beyond repair and requires replacement?
A: If your door has extensive damage, such as big fractures, substantial warping, or numerous failed repair efforts, it may be more cost-effective to change it. A brand-new door can also improve energy effectiveness and security.
